Abstract

Codebooks with constant modulus entries are being considered for the limited feedback beamforming multiple-input-multiple-output (MIMO) system to improve the power amplifier efficiency at the transmitter. Assume that one such codebook is known to both the transmitter and receiver. The receiver must determine a target codeword from this codebook and send its index back to the transmitter. A receiver can be implemented with low cost if fast codeword selection algorithm is executed. In this study, the authors utilise the properties possessed by three such codebooks and propose a novel tree search algorithm for fast codeword selection. Compared with two previously reported codeword selection algorithms, our algorithm is of fixed complexity and does find the target codeword. Furthermore, our algorithm for codeword selection is similar to the tree search for MIMO detection. These two similar tree search algorithms for both codeword selection and MIMO detection can be implemented by the same hardware architecture. A baseband receiver with small chip area for the dual-mode (the spatial multiplexing and beamforming transmission modes) MIMO system is possible.
